A magnitude 5.3 earthquake struck about 151 kilometers (94 miles) west southwest of Adak, Alaska, on September 11, 2026, at 10:47 UTC, according to the U.S. Geological Survey. The agency placed the epicenter at 51.213 degrees north, 178.543 degrees west, at a depth of roughly 40.9 kilometers (25.4 miles). The USGS reported a ShakeMap intensity of V, indicating moderate shaking near the epicenter.

CONTEXT
The Aleutian Islands arc curves roughly 1,900 kilometers from the Alaska Peninsula toward Russia's Kamchatka Peninsula and marks where the Pacific plate dives beneath the North American plate. That subduction zone produces frequent earthquakes, and the USGS event page is the standard public record for each one. The agency's ShakeMap system estimates shaking intensity from instrument readings and ground motion models; intensity V on the Modified Mercalli scale corresponds to shaking felt widely but causing at most light damage. The USGS summary did not list casualties, damage or a tsunami warning. WHY IT MATTERS
The Aleutian arc is one of the most seismically active places on Earth, and offshore quakes there can generate tsunamis that cross the Pacific within hours.
